#include<stdio.h>intmain(){int x;float y;// ⽤⼾输⼊ " -13.45e12# 0"scanf("%d",&x);printf("%d\n",x);scanf("%f",&y);printf("%f\n",y);return0;} 上⾯⽰例中, scanf() 读取⽤⼾输⼊时, %d 占位符会忽略起⾸的空格,从 - 处开始获取数据,读 取到-13 停下来,...
scanf() 函数⽤于读取用户的键盘输⼊。程序运⾏到这个语句时,会停下来,等待⽤户从键盘输⼊。⽤户输⼊数据、按下回⻋键后,scanf() 就会处理用户的输⼊,将其存⼊变量。它的原型定义在头⽂件 stdio.h 。scanf() 的语法跟 printf() 类似。 scanf("%d", &i); 1. 它的第⼀个参数是...
1 printf("Please input your age:"); 2 3 int age; 4 scanf("%d", &age); 5 6 printf("Your age is %d.", age); * 运行程序,执行完第1行代码,控制台会输出一句提示信息: * 执行到第4行的scanf函数时,会等待用户的键盘输入,并不会往后执行代码。scanf的第1个参数是"%d",说明要求用户以10进制...
scanf("格式控制字符串", 地址列表); 例如: scanf("%d", &num); 基本用法 地址列表项中只能传入变量地址, 变量地址可以通过&符号+变量名称的形式获取 代码语言:javascript 复制 #include <stdio.h> int main(){ int number; scanf("%d", &number); // 接收一个整数 printf("number = %d\n", number...
1、printf和scanf详解介绍 1.1 printf printf函数为库函数,给uu们两个查看库函数的方式,第一个下载msdn软件进行查找相关库函数知识,第二个用cplusplus网站查询库函数(建议使用旧版的,旧版的有搜索功能)。 cplusplus网站链接 旧版使用 注:msdn为小型软件,如果需要可以私信博主。
printf("My height is %8.1f",179.95f); 输出结果: 输出宽度为8,保留1位小数 二、scanf函数 这也是在stdio.h中声明的一个函数,因此使用前必须加入#include 。调用scanf函数时,需要传入变量的地址作为参数,scanf函数会等待标准输入设备(比如键盘)输入数据,并且将输入的数据赋值给地址对应的变量 ...
printf("My height is %.2f",179.95f); 输出结果: * 当然,可以同时设置输出宽度和小数位数 printf("My height is %8.1f",179.95f); 输出结果: ,输出宽度为8,保留1位小数 二、scanf函数 这也是在stdio.h中声明的一个函数,因此使用前必须加入#include <stdio.h>。调用scanf函数时,需要传入变量的地址作为参...
printf("My height is %8.1f",179.95f); 输出结果: 输出宽度为8,保留1位小数 二、scanf函数 这也是在stdio.h中声明的一个函数,因此使用前必须加入#include 。调用scanf函数时,需要传入变量的地址作为参数,scanf函数会等待标准输入设备(比如键盘)输入数据,并且将输入的数据赋值给地址对应的变量 ...
【C语言】05-printf和scanf函数,一、printf函数这是在stdio.h中声明的一个函数,因此使用前必须加入#include<stdio.h>,使用它可以向标准输出设备(比如屏幕)输出数据1.用法1>printf(字符串)输出结果是:2>printf(字符串,格式符参数)*格式符%d表示以有符号的十进制形式输
一、printf 1.基础用法 2.占位符 3.占位符列表 4.限定宽度 4.1整数 4.2小数 5.限定小数位数 6.输出部分字符串 7.显示正负号 二、scanf 1.基础用法 2.scanf的返回值 3.占位符 4.赋值忽略符 5消除scanf()警告 总结 前言 printf()和scanf()这两个函数在写代码时总是使用,接下来让我们好好康康它们,究竟...